Top 5 Skid Steer Maintenance Tips

дец 04, 2025

A Skid Steer is one of the most versatile and hardworking machines on any job site. But without proper maintenance, even the best model can suffer from downtime, costly repairs, and reduced productivity. Whether you're a contractor, farmer, landscaper, or rental operator, keeping your machine in top condition directly saves time and money.


This guide covers the Top 5 Skid Steer Maintenance Tips that every owner and operator should follow to maximize performance and extend machine life.

1. Perform Daily Inspections Before Operation

Daily checkups might seem simple, but they prevent 80% of unexpected failures.

A quick walk-around before starting your Skid Steer helps detect leaks or damage early. Small issues—such as a loose hose or worn tyre—are far cheaper to fix before they escalate into major breakdowns.

2. Keep the Hydraulic System Clean and Well-Maintained

The hydraulic system is the “heart” of your Skid Steer. If it fails, attachments cannot function, and your machine becomes useless.

Hydraulic contamination is one of the top causes of Skid Steer downtime. Keeping the system clean greatly extends the machine’s lifespan.

3. Maintain Proper Tire or Track Tension

Whether you use a wheeled or tracked Skid Steer, traction is critical.

Incorrect track or tire tension increases fuel consumption, reduces stability, and accelerates wear on the drive system.


4. Clean the Cooling System Regularly

Skid Steers often work in dusty, muddy, or hot conditions—making overheating a common risk.

A clean cooling system helps the engine run more efficiently and prevents overheating-related damage.

5. Follow a Strict Engine & Filter Service Schedule

Your Skid Steer engine is the core of your machine’s power. Skipping service intervals shortens the life of the engine dramatically.

Consistent servicing improves performance, lowers fuel consumption, and minimizes repair costs.

Bonus Tip: Use High-Quality Attachments & Parts

Low-quality attachments stress your Skid Steer’s hydraulic system, lift arms, and drivetrain. Always choose compatible, durable parts from reliable manufacturers. This ensures smoother operation and reduces long-term maintenance costs.
